技术文摘
汇总常见的数据库连接方式
汇总常见的数据库连接方式
在软件开发与数据处理领域,数据库连接是一项基础且关键的操作。不同的数据库管理系统有着各自的特点,对应的连接方式也有所差异。以下为大家汇总几种常见的数据库连接方式。
JDBC 连接:JDBC(Java Database Connectivity)是 Java 编程语言中用于执行 SQL 语句的 API。它为 Java 开发者提供了一个统一的接口来访问各种关系型数据库,如 MySQL、Oracle 等。使用 JDBC 连接数据库,首先要加载数据库驱动程序,通过 DriverManager 类来获取数据库连接对象。例如连接 MySQL 数据库,需要导入相应的 JDBC 驱动包,然后编写代码指定数据库的 URL、用户名和密码,进而建立连接。JDBC 的优势在于其跨数据库的通用性以及与 Java 生态系统的紧密集成,广泛应用于 Java Web 应用开发中。
ODBC 连接:ODBC(Open Database Connectivity)是微软提出的一种用于访问数据库的统一接口标准。它允许应用程序以一种标准的方式与各种不同的数据库进行通信,适用于 Windows 平台上多种数据库的连接。ODBC 通过 ODBC 驱动程序管理器来管理和加载特定数据库的驱动程序。不过,由于 ODBC 基于 C 语言,对于一些高级编程语言而言,使用起来相对复杂,在现代开发中使用频率有所下降,但在某些特定场景仍发挥着作用。
ADO.NET 连接:ADO.NET 是.NET 框架中用于数据访问的技术。它为.NET 开发者提供了访问各种数据源的能力,包括关系型数据库、XML 数据等。在连接 SQL Server 数据库时,ADO.NET 提供了专门的 SqlConnection 类,使用时需引用相应的命名空间,设置连接字符串,包含数据源、数据库名称、用户名、密码等信息,从而实现连接。ADO.NET 具有性能高效、与.NET 环境紧密结合的特点,在基于.NET 框架开发的应用中被大量采用。
以上这些常见的数据库连接方式,各有特点与适用场景。开发者需要根据项目的具体需求、数据库类型以及开发语言等因素,合理选择合适的连接方式,确保数据的高效、稳定访问。
- 程序员关键技能:明晰何时不写代码
- Docker 与 Kubernetes 架构:神话抑或现实?
- 谷歌发布 Flutter1.9 实现 Flutter 网页版并入主代码库
- 借助 HTTPie 开展 API 测试
- PHP 五十个提升执行效率的技巧及常见问题解析
- Python 连续 3 年稳坐第一,PHP 跌出前十:IEEE 编程语言排行榜公布
- 当下 7 大热门 Github 机器学习创新项目盘点
- 必藏!16 段代码带你走进 Python 循环语句
- 性能测试的关键要点需重视
- 30 亿日志的检索、分页与后台展示,还有更奇葩的需求吗?
- 前端项目代码质量的保障之法
- 深入解读递归:你是否误解了它
- 轻松区分 CountDownLatch 与 CyclicBarrier:高并发编程解析
- 16 岁的全栈开发者:从游戏开发到加密货币投资机器人的逐梦之旅
- 每秒 100 万请求下 12306 秒杀业务的架构优化之道